
PYCharm如何Python:安装、配置与高效使用
安装PyCharm、配置解释器、创建项目、使用基本功能
安装PyCharm
要在你的计算机上使用PyCharm,首先需要下载安装该软件。JetBrains提供了PyCharm的两个版本:社区版(免费)和专业版(付费)。根据你的需要选择合适的版本。以下是安装步骤:
-
下载PyCharm:访问JetBrains的官方网站,找到PyCharm的下载页面,选择适合你操作系统的安装包进行下载。
-
安装PyCharm:下载完成后,运行安装包并按照提示进行安装。通常安装过程非常简单,只需不断点击“下一步”即可。
-
启动PyCharm:安装完成后,启动PyCharm。首次启动时,PyCharm会要求你进行一些初始设置,包括选择UI主题和导入配置文件(如果有)。
配置Python解释器
PyCharm是一个集成开发环境(IDE),其强大的功能之一就是可以配置多个Python解释器。配置Python解释器的步骤如下:
-
打开设置:在PyCharm的菜单栏中,点击
File->Settings(Windows/Linux)或PyCharm->Preferences(macOS)。 -
选择解释器:在设置窗口中,导航到
Project->Python Interpreter。在这里,你可以看到当前项目使用的解释器。 -
添加解释器:点击右上角的齿轮图标,然后选择
Add...。你可以选择现有的Python安装,也可以创建一个新的虚拟环境。 -
应用设置:选择合适的解释器后,点击
OK或Apply来保存设置。
创建Python项目
创建一个新的Python项目是使用PyCharm的第一步。以下是详细步骤:
-
启动PyCharm:启动PyCharm并在欢迎界面选择
Create New Project。 -
选择项目位置:在新项目对话框中,选择项目的保存位置。
-
配置项目解释器:选择该项目使用的解释器。你可以选择之前配置的解释器,也可以创建一个新的虚拟环境。
-
完成创建:点击
Create,PyCharm将创建一个新的项目并打开项目窗口。
使用基本功能
PyCharm提供了许多强大的功能来帮助你编写和调试Python代码。以下是一些基本功能的介绍:
-
代码编辑:PyCharm的代码编辑器支持语法高亮、代码补全和实时错误检查。你可以在编辑器中编写Python代码,PyCharm会自动提供代码建议并标记错误。
-
运行和调试:你可以在PyCharm中直接运行Python脚本。点击编辑器顶部的绿色箭头按钮即可运行当前脚本。要调试代码,可以在代码中设置断点,然后点击调试按钮来启动调试器。
-
版本控制:PyCharm集成了Git等版本控制系统。你可以在PyCharm中直接进行代码提交、分支管理等操作。
-
插件和扩展:PyCharm支持安装各种插件来扩展其功能。你可以在设置中找到
Plugins选项,搜索并安装所需的插件。
一、安装PYCharm
1. 下载和安装
PyCharm是一款由JetBrains开发的Python IDE,其强大的功能和友好的用户界面受到了广大开发者的喜爱。要开始使用PyCharm,首先需要在官方页面下载并安装。社区版是免费的,而专业版则需要付费。安装步骤如下:
- 访问JetBrains官方网站,找到PyCharm的下载页面。
- 选择适合你操作系统的安装包(Windows、macOS、Linux)。
- 下载完成后,运行安装程序,按照提示完成安装。
2. 启动和初始设置
安装完成后,启动PyCharm。首次启动时,PyCharm会进行一些初始设置,包括选择UI主题、配置插件等。你可以根据自己的喜好进行选择。
二、配置Python解释器
1. 添加解释器
在PyCharm中配置Python解释器是非常重要的一步。你可以选择系统中已安装的Python版本,也可以创建虚拟环境。以下是详细步骤:
- 打开PyCharm,进入
File->Settings(Windows)或PyCharm->Preferences(macOS)。 - 在设置窗口中,导航到
Project->Python Interpreter。 - 点击右上角的齿轮图标,选择
Add...。 - 选择合适的Python解释器或创建新的虚拟环境。
- 点击
OK或Apply保存设置。
2. 虚拟环境的使用
虚拟环境是Python开发中常用的工具,它可以让你在不同项目中使用不同的库版本,从而避免库版本冲突。PyCharm可以方便地创建和管理虚拟环境。在添加解释器时,选择New environment,然后指定虚拟环境的路径和基于的Python版本即可。
三、创建和管理项目
1. 创建新项目
在PyCharm中创建新项目非常简单。启动PyCharm后,在欢迎界面选择Create New Project。然后按照以下步骤操作:
- 选择项目的保存位置。
- 配置项目解释器,可以选择之前配置的解释器或创建新的虚拟环境。
- 点击
Create,PyCharm将创建一个新的项目并打开项目窗口。
2. 项目结构和文件管理
PyCharm中项目的结构和文件管理非常直观。在项目窗口中,你可以看到项目的目录树,所有的文件和文件夹都可以在这里进行管理。你可以右键点击文件夹或文件,进行新建、重命名、删除等操作。
四、编写和运行Python代码
1. 编写代码
PyCharm的代码编辑器功能强大,支持语法高亮、代码补全、实时错误检查等功能。在编辑器中编写Python代码时,PyCharm会自动提供代码建议,并在发现错误时标记出来。
2. 运行代码
在PyCharm中运行Python脚本非常简单。你可以点击编辑器顶部的绿色箭头按钮来运行当前脚本。PyCharm会在下方的运行窗口中显示输出结果。如果你需要传递命令行参数,可以在运行配置中进行设置。
3. 调试代码
PyCharm的调试功能非常强大。你可以在代码中设置断点,然后点击调试按钮来启动调试器。在调试模式下,你可以逐步执行代码,查看变量的值,分析代码的执行流程,从而快速定位和解决问题。
五、版本控制
1. Git集成
PyCharm集成了Git等版本控制系统,你可以在PyCharm中直接进行代码提交、分支管理等操作。以下是一些常见的Git操作:
- 初始化仓库:在项目窗口中右键点击项目根目录,选择
Git->Enable Version Control Integration,然后选择Git。 - 提交代码:在编辑器中进行代码修改后,点击顶部的
Commit按钮,填写提交信息,然后点击Commit或Commit and Push。 - 管理分支:点击右下角的分支名,可以进行分支切换、新建、合并等操作。
2. 版本控制操作
除了Git,PyCharm还支持SVN、Mercurial等版本控制系统。你可以在设置中找到Version Control选项,配置和管理不同的版本控制系统。
六、插件和扩展
1. 安装插件
PyCharm支持安装各种插件来扩展其功能。你可以在设置中找到Plugins选项,搜索并安装所需的插件。以下是一些常用插件:
- Markdown:支持Markdown文件的编辑和预览。
- Docker:支持Docker容器的管理和使用。
- Database Tools:支持数据库的连接和管理。
2. 配置和使用插件
安装插件后,你可以在设置中对其进行配置。不同插件的配置方法可能有所不同,具体可以参考插件的使用文档。安装和配置完成后,你可以在PyCharm中使用插件提供的各种功能。
七、提高开发效率的技巧
1. 快捷键使用
使用快捷键可以大大提高开发效率。PyCharm提供了丰富的快捷键,你可以在设置中找到Keymap选项,查看和自定义快捷键。以下是一些常用的快捷键:
- Ctrl + Space:代码补全。
- Ctrl + Shift + F10:运行当前脚本。
- Ctrl + Shift + A:查找和执行命令。
2. 自定义代码模板
PyCharm支持自定义代码模板,你可以在设置中找到Editor -> Live Templates选项,添加和管理代码模板。使用代码模板可以快速插入常用的代码片段,提高编写代码的效率。
八、常见问题和解决方法
1. 解释器配置问题
在使用PyCharm时,可能会遇到解释器配置问题。例如,无法找到Python解释器,或解释器版本不匹配。解决方法如下:
- 检查Python安装路径:确保Python已正确安装,并检查其路径是否正确。
- 重新配置解释器:在设置中重新配置解释器,确保选择正确的Python版本。
2. 代码运行错误
在运行Python代码时,可能会遇到各种运行错误。例如,模块未找到,或语法错误。解决方法如下:
- 检查代码:仔细检查代码,确保没有语法错误。
- 安装依赖库:确保已安装所有依赖库,可以使用
pip install命令安装所需的库。
1. PingCode的使用
PingCode是一款研发项目管理系统,适用于软件开发团队。你可以在PingCode中创建和管理项目、任务和需求。以下是一些常用功能:
- 创建项目:在PingCode中创建新项目,设置项目名称、描述和成员等信息。
- 管理任务:在项目中创建和分配任务,设置任务的优先级、截止日期等。
- 跟踪进度:使用看板、甘特图等工具,跟踪项目的进度和状态。
2. Worktile的使用
Worktile是一款通用项目管理软件,适用于各类团队和项目。你可以在Worktile中创建和管理项目、任务和日程。以下是一些常用功能:
- 创建项目:在Worktile中创建新项目,设置项目名称、描述和成员等信息。
- 管理任务:在项目中创建和分配任务,设置任务的优先级、截止日期等。
- 协作与沟通:使用Worktile的消息和讨论功能,与团队成员进行沟通和协作。
通过以上步骤和技巧,你可以高效地使用PyCharm进行Python开发,并在项目管理中使用PingCode和Worktile来提高团队的协作效率。希望本文能帮助你更好地理解和使用PyCharm及相关工具。
相关问答FAQs:
FAQ 1: 如何在PyCharm中运行Python程序?
- 打开PyCharm,并创建一个新的Python项目。
- 在项目中创建一个新的Python文件。
- 在文件中编写你的Python代码。
- 点击运行按钮(绿色的三角形图标)或按下快捷键Shift + F10来运行你的程序。
FAQ 2: 如何在PyCharm中安装Python库?
- 打开PyCharm,并打开你的Python项目。
- 点击顶部菜单栏的"File",然后选择"Settings"。
- 在弹出窗口中,选择"Project: [你的项目名]",然后选择"Python Interpreter"。
- 在右侧窗口中,点击"+"按钮来添加新的Python库。
- 在搜索框中输入你想要安装的库的名称,然后点击"Install Package"来安装它。
FAQ 3: 如何在PyCharm中进行Python调试?
- 打开PyCharm,并打开你的Python项目。
- 在你想要设置断点的代码行上,单击左侧的行号区域。这将在该行上创建一个红色圆点,表示断点已设置。
- 点击运行按钮(绿色的三角形图标)或按下快捷键Shift + F10来开始调试。
- 当程序运行到断点处时,程序将暂停执行,并且你可以使用调试工具栏上的按钮来逐步执行代码、查看变量的值等。
文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/718409